JOB SUMMARY

We are seeking a Senior Marketing Specialist to support the growth of PRI programs according to their unique needs. This role will collaborate with program teams to deliver best in class results that generate actional leads and positions PRI as a thought leader in the marketplace. The Senior Marketing Specialist will be responsible for understanding program goals and utilizing this knowledge to develop and implement marketing plans, campaigns, and tactics. This position is also responsible for defining marketing projects for implementation by staff and agencies, establishing appropriate metrics and analyzing overall results of marketing strategies, and interface with PRI program teams.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

  • Attain deep and meaningful understanding of PRI's strategic plan, industry/sector-specific dynamics, program portfolio plans, customer data, market surveys, customer activity trends, and independent observations to develop and implement marketing communication tactics to support PRI programs
  • Drive collaboration and development of high-impact marketing plans and programs for new product development/go-to-market as well as existing activities by pro-actively developing strong business relationships and becoming embedded in program teams.
  • Actively manage status of ongoing marketing projects and elevate potential issues/roadblocks to appropriate levels for proper and timely mitigation.
  • Work closely with the marketing team and the assigned program teams on administration/execution of assigned activities.
  • Collaborate with Content Specialist to align program goals in the development of engaging and compelling content needed to generate a content marketing engine that supports customer, member and prospect needs feeding the integrated communications plans.

ABOUT THE ORGANIZATION

Fullsight is an integrated brand of our three primary affiliate companies - SAE Industry Technologies Consortia, SAE International and Performance Review Institute - and their subsidiaries. As a collective, Fullsight enables a robust resource of innovative programs, products and services for industries, their engineers, and technical experts to work together on traditional and emergent.

SAE IndustryTechnologies Consortia® (SAE ITC)enables organizations to define and pilot best practices. SAE ITC industry stakeholders are able to work together to effectively solve common problems, achieve mutual benefit for industry, and create business value.

The Performance Review Institute® (PRI)is the world leader in facilitating collaborative supply chain oversight programs, quality management systems approvals, and professional development in industries where safety and quality are shared values.

SAE International® (SAEI)is a global organization serving the mobility sector, predominantly in the aerospace, automotive and commercial-vehicle industries, fostering innovation, and enabling engineering professionals. Since 1905, SAE has harnessed the collective wisdom of engineers around the world to create industry-enabling standards. Likewise, SAE members have advanced their knowledge and understanding of mobility engineering through our information resources, professional development, and networking.
